About Mew
One of Denmark’s most lauded bands, Mew specializes in amped-up art-rock. The group’s dramatic and dynamic sound was honed in the late 1990s, but came to full fruition on its 2003 major-label debut, FRENGERS, which showcases both Mew’s shoegazer leanings and its bold, stadium-ready aesthetic. Issued in ’05, AND THE GLASS HANDED KITES further explored Mew’s heavier side and expanded its international following. With a guest appearance by Dinosaur Jr.’s J. Mascis (on “Why Are You Looking Grave?”), KITES also pointed to Mew’s considerable debt to early ‘90s alt-rock, an influence proudly embraced by the Danish ensemble.
